Types of Mental Health Providers in Water Valley, MS
No two people with mental illness experience it in the exact same way. As such, there are various types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.
Psychologists in Water Valley
A psychologist is a mental health professional who is trained and educated to conduct psychological evaluations and provide diagnoses. They’re also trained in hel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. Much of their practice revolves around identifying and changing dest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.
Psychiatrists in Water Valley
Psychiatrists are medical doctors (M.D) who have received psychiatric training. Unlike psychologists, they are able to prescribe medications. As such, psychiatrists are regularly employed to help treat chronic disorders or serious mental illness (SMI), conditions that require medical treatment. Despite the fact that they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), some psychiatrists choose not to.
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Water Valley
Each of these terms are interchangeable and are used to describe mental health care professionals who have completed a master degree in in a field related to mental or public health. They work more similarly to psychologists than psychiatrists, being treatment-focused often with an emphasis on modifying behavior. More often than not, individual and group therapy is the primary treatment option.
Paying for Water Valley Mental Health Rehab
Everything costs something - including mental healthcare The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Here is a breakdown of all of the possible ways to pay for mental health treatment:
- Private Insurance might be offered through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. Private insurance can also be purchased directly from the ins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through the Healthcare Marketplace to individuals who earn a low income, yet do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Self-Pay] - If a patient is able to, they may pay for their mental health treatment Water Valley out-of-pocket. People who can self-pay - but not all at once - may ask about a payment plan or line of credit.
- Scholarships - Certain mental health rehabs Water Valley offer scholarship opportunities for people who express a strong yearning and commitment to getting better, but do not have the treatment.
- “Free” Programs - Private and public not-for-profit organizations allocate funds to provide mental health services to their local community. However, there may be a long waiting period in areas with a greater need for these services.
